    Myofusion Probiotic Vanilla Review!



    First, I must thank Zach and Gaspari Nutrition for the speedy delivery of this DELICIOUS addition to my morning oatmeal

    | Profile |
    9/10
    150 calories
    2g Fat
    9g Carbs
    -1g Fiber
    -3g Sugar
    24g Protein


    If I were still carbophobic, I'd despise this protein - however, I'm in recovery, so it wasn't an issue. On a more serious note, it is a lot of protein in a small amount of calories. The term probiotic refers to healthy digestive and immune function, however the fiber is low. I assumed with the amount of carbs, at least more of them would be from fiber.

    | Mixability |
    8.5/10
    *I'm going to base this solely off of how it mixed with a fork for some Myofusion Vanilla Protein Pancake batter, and with a spoon in my oatmeal because I use a blender for my shakes, therefore it's never usually an issue with those.

    *Will add pics in AM!

    It mixed incredibly with egg whites and water for my protein pancake batter. I barely had to break up any clumps, although the fork may have helped. In my oatmeal, it was a bit less easy to mix up. I had to add some additional water because it became a chalky oatball instead. Maybe I used too much protein, but in the past one full scoop of powder has always been fine.

    | Texture |
    10/10
    Gaspari really hit the nail on the head in the Probiotic series with this. The texture is perfect - I found the original version to be a bit too thick sometimes, but this series is perfect. It was super creamy for my pancakes and with a little baking powder, it reacted SUPER amazing.

    | Taste |
    8/10

    The vanilla has a great taste to it, but it is easily masked by other things and, if not mixed properly, can taste very watered down. I really do enjoy the taste, but it's a bit of an effort to make sure it is strong enough to stand out. I really do prefer it over the MANY vanilla flavored proteins I have tried, though. The taste is fantastic for the fact that it contains no aspartame, though. I believe Gaspari will see an increase in sales for this reason (not that I particularly care).

    | Overall |
    9/10

    It is an incredible product, as most Gaspari products are. The highlights of this product, as stated online:
    "Incredible Taste, Mixes Easily.
    Advanced six stage protein blend.
    Patented Ganeden BC30 (Bacillus coagulans GBI-30, 6086) Probiotic to support immune and digestive health.*
    Features Whey Protein Concentrate, Brown Rice Protein Concentrate, Whey Protein Isolate, Casein Milk Protein Isolate, Egg Albumin, and fast acting Whey Protein Hydrolysate.
    Over 9 grams of essential Amino Acids (EAAs) to support recovery.
    Gluten and Aspartame free formula.
    Manufactured in a SQF 2000 facility."


    This protein powder has more packed into it than any other on the market, making it a stand-up product and an A+ in my book!
